As an HCP Marketing Manager in specialty immunology, you will be leading key projects focused on the development of HCP personal promotional tactics across multiple indications. Candidate should be a self-starter, who has a passion for ensuring marketing campaigns are customer focused, competitive, and innovative. This role will provide YOU the opportunity to lead key activities to progress YOUR career, responsibilities include…Lead development of assigned HCP personal promotional tactics – including developing project briefs to ensure promotional materials will deliver on the brand strategy and meet business objectives

Create and deliver robust field engagement plans providing clarity of direction and rationale for requested activities to ensure customer-facing teams have innovative materials necessary to effectively engage customers in complaint discussions

Develop effective working relationships and engage across relevant stakeholders (Brand & Sales Leaders, Medical, Marketing Directors, Legal/Regulatory)
Strategically align product and its attributes to identified marketplace needs through application of learnings from market research, data analysis, and insight generation

Effectively lead cross-functional team of internal and external partners, including multiple agencies (professional AOR, scientific communications agency, etc.) and project teams to drive execution

Work effectively and collaboratively as an equal partner across a matrix marketing organization

Measure and track performance of key tactics

Work closely with marketing Directors to ensure tactics align with and support brand strategies and objectives
